The private international law rules for insurance contracts in the European Insurance Directives are of great importance to every lawyer involved in international business. These provisions become relevant whenever one is dealing with insurance products in a European context.

These rules, which apply to insurance contracts covering risks situated in the territories of the Member States of the European Community, have currently been implemented by all the Member States of the European Union.

The purpose of this book is to analyse the implementation rules of these choice of laws provisions in all the member States of the European Union. This Volume concentrates on seven major States, such as Belgium, France, Germany, Italy, The Netherlands, Spain, and the United Kingdom. Seven expert reports give an overview of the current state of the law. Insights are given into national practice and theoretical aspects are not neglected. This work is a unique collection which both scholars and practitioners will find to be an invaluable source of reference in order to understand the complicated issues arising where cross border transactions occur in the field of insurance.
